Role of Tamil Nadu in World War I and II
Tamil Nadu's contribution to the World Wars was substantial, with thousands of men enlisting in the British Indian Army. These brave soldiers served in diverse theaters of war, including Europe, North Africa, and Southeast Asia, fighting alongside Allied forces. Tamil Nadu also served as a crucial training and logistical hub for the British Indian Army, with several military installations and training centers established in the region.

Economic and Social Consequences
The World Wars had a profound impact on the economy and society of Tamil Nadu. The region experienced a surge in industrial activity, as factories and manufacturing units were repurposed to produce war-related supplies. This led to increased employment opportunities and a boost to the local economy. However, the war also brought about hardships, including shortages of essential commodities, rising prices, and economic disruption.
The social fabric of Tamil Nadu was also affected by the wars. The departure of thousands of young men to distant battlefields created a void in families and communities. Women were forced to take on new roles and responsibilities, challenging traditional gender norms. The war also fostered a sense of national consciousness and solidarity among the people of Tamil Nadu, as they united in support of the war effort.
